Wavelength‐Dependent Photobiomodulation Regulates Macrophage Polarization via Mitochondrial Dynamics and Metabolic Reprogramming

open access: yesAdvanced Science, EarlyView.
Light wavelength encodes distinct macrophage fates through mitochondrial and metabolic remodeling. Red 625 nm irradiation induces glycolysis, mitochondrial fission, and M1 polarization, whereas near‐infrared 850 nm irradiation promotes fatty acid oxidation, mitochondrial fusion, and M2 polarization.

Controllable Carbon Shell Encapsulation via Rapid Joule Heating Calcination for High‐Performance Asymmetric Supercapacitor With Suppressed Self‐Discharge and Robust Cycling Stability

open access: yesAdvanced Science, EarlyView.
The H‐Fe3O4@C negative electrode and H‐NiCo2S4@C positive electrode are designed through a controllable carbon shell encapsulation strategy. The as‐constructed asymmetric supercapacitor presents robust cycling stability with 93.7% capacity retention after 25 000 cycles.

Formation of Gallium Monofluoride in the Coordination Sphere of Nickel

open access: yesAngewandte Chemie, EarlyView.
The elusive gas‐phase species gallium monofluoride forms selectively in the coordination sphere of a nickel(II) centre as a product of C(sp3)–F bond activation, with a weakly coordinating anion as the fluorine source.
